Nick Terrell e2d01863bc [linux-kernel] Don't add -O3 to CFLAGS
It is no longer necessary to get good performance, there is only a small
speed difference between -O2 and -O3, so just stick to the default of
-O2. I've measured neutral compression speed and a ~3% decompression
speed loss in userspace with clang & gcc. I've also measured neutral
compression speed and a ~1% decompression speed loss in the kernel
benchmarks.

This also fixes the stack space usage on parisc. The compiler was buggy
for -O3 and used ~3KB of stack space for several functions. With -O2 the
problem is completely resolved, and stack space is back to a few hundred
bytes.

Additionally, we get a large code size win on gcc:

| Compiler | Before (Bytes) | After (Bytes) | Delta (Bytes) |
|----------|----------------|---------------|---------------|
| gcc-11   |         952754 |        738954 |       -213800 |
| clang-12 |         976290 |        938826 |        -37464 |

Nick Terrell 802ea885ef Reduce function size in fast & dfast
Take the same approach as in PR #2828 [0] to remove functions that force
inline many function bodies and `switch`. Instead, create one function per
"template" combination, and then switch between these functions. This
allows the compiler to break the large function into many small
functions, which generally helps codegen.

Also, in the `extDict` modes when there is no ext-dict, call the top
level function instead of the force inlined one, to save on code size.

I'm specifically doing this because gcc on the parisc architecture doesn't
handle the large function body well, and ends up using a lot of excess
stack space. Outlining these functions fixes it.

Nick Terrell 13cad3abb1 [lazy] Speed up compilation times
Speed up compilation times by moving each specialized search function
into its own function. This is faster because compilers can handle many
smaller functions much faster than one gigantic function. The previous
approach generated one giant function with `switch` statements and
inlining to select the implementation.

| Compiler | Flags                               | Dev Time (s) | PR Time (s) | Delta |
|----------|-------------------------------------|--------------|-------------|-------|
| gcc      | -O3                                 |         16.5 |         5.6 |  -66% |
| gcc      | -O3 -g -fsanitize=address,undefined |        158.9 |        38.2 |  -75% |
| clang    | -O3                                 |         36.5 |         5.5 |  -85% |
| clang    | -O3 -g -fsanitize=address,undefined |         27.8 |        17.5 |  -37% |

This also reduces the binary size because the search functions are no
longer inlined into the main body.

| Compiler | Dev libzstd.a Size (B) | PR libzstd.a Size (B) | Delta |
|----------|------------------------|-----------------------|-------|
| gcc      |                1563868 |               1308844 |  -16% |
| clang    |                1924372 |               1376020 |  -28% |

Finally, the performance is not impacted significantly by this change,
in fact we generally see a small speed boost.

| Compiler | Level | Dev Speed (MB/s) | PR Speed (MB/s) | Delta |
|----------|-------|------------------|-----------------|-------|
| gcc      |     5 |            110.6 |           110.0 | -0.5% |
| gcc      |     7 |             70.4 |            72.2 | +2.5% |
| gcc      |     9 |             53.2 |            53.5 | +0.5% |
| gcc      |    13 |             12.7 |            12.9 | +1.5% |
| clang    |     5 |            113.9 |           110.4 | -3.0% |
| clang    |     7 |             67.7 |            70.6 | +4.2% |
| clang    |     9 |             51.9 |            52.2 | +0.5% |
| clang    |    13 |             12.4 |            13.3 | +7.2% |

The compression strategy is unmodified in this PR, so the compressed size
should be exactly the same. I may have a follow up PR to slightly improve
the compression ratio, if it doesn't cost too much speed.

Nick Terrell a07ddb47f7 [huf] Fix OSS-Fuzz assert
PR #2784 introduced a bug in the decompressor that caused some valid
inputs to fail to decompress. The bitstream isn't reloaded after the 4X*
loop if the number of elements remaining is small enough, causing us to
read more bits than are available in the bitcontainer.

This was caught by the MSAN fuzzer in OSS-Fuzz because the assembly
implementation isn't used in the MSAN build.

Credit to OSS-Fuzz.

Nick Terrell a418b4e478 [rsyncable] Ensure ZSTD_compressBound() is respected
In degenerate cases `--rsyncable` could create very small blocks (1
byte). This causes the compressed output to be larger than
`ZSTD_compressBound()`. Fix the issue by ensuring that rsyncable mode
never outputs blocks smaller than 128 KB.

The minimum job size is 512 KB, so we shouldn't lose many
synchronization points from skipping any that cause blocks smaller than
128 KB. And even if we do, that is fine, because we'll find the next
one.

This fixes the `raw_dictionary_round_trip` oss-fuzz assert.

Nick Terrell 05b6773fbc [fix] Add missing bounds checks during compression
* The block splitter missed a bounds check, so when the buffer is too small it
  passes an erroneously large size to `ZSTD_entropyCompressSeqStore()`, which
  can then write the compressed data past the end of the buffer. This is a new
  regression in v1.5.0 when the block splitter is enabled. It is either enabled
  explicitly, or implicitly when using the optimal parser and `ZSTD_compress2()`
  or `ZSTD_compressStream*()`.
* `HUF_writeCTable_wksp()` omits a bounds check when calling
  `HUF_compressWeights()`. If it is called with `dstCapacity == 0` it will pass
  an erroneously large size to `HUF_compressWeights()`, which can then write
  past the end of the buffer. This bug has been present for ages. However, I
  believe that zstd cannot trigger the bug, because it never calls
  `HUF_compress*()` with `dstCapacity == 0` because of [this check][1].

Credit to: Oss-Fuzz

Nick Terrell 03c4111299 [lib] Fix dictionary invalidation logic
Call `ZSTD_enforceMaxDist()` before each block with the beginning of the
block. This ensures that `lowLimit` is updated to `dictLimit` whenever
the ext-dict is out of range, so we can use prefix mode for speed.

This can cause non-determinism because prefix mode and ext-dict mode
match finders can return different results. It can also hurt speed
because ext-dict match finders are slower.

The scenario is:
1. Compress large data with a dictionary.
2. The dictionary goes out of bounds, so we invalidate it.
3. However, we still have `lowLimit < dictLimit`, since it is
   never updated.
4. We will call the ext-dict match finder instead of the prefix one.

Nick Terrell 91c9a247b6 [lib] Fix determinism bug in the optimal parser
`ZSTD_insertBt1()` has a speed optimization that skips the prefix of
very long matches.

https://github.com/facebook/zstd/blob/40def70387f99b239f3f566ba399275a8fd44cde/lib/compress/zstd_opt.c#L476

This optimization is based off the length longest match found. However,
when indices are reset, we only ensure that we can reference the whole
window starting from `ip`. If the previous block ended with a long match
then `nextToUpdate` could be much less than `ip`. It might be far enough
back that `nextToUpdate < maxDist`, so it doesn't have a full window of
data to reference. This can cause non-determinism bugs, because we may
find a match that is beyond `ip - maxDist`, and may sometimes be
un-referencable, and that match triggers the speed optimization.

The fix is to base the `windowLow` off of the `target` of
`ZSTD_updateTree_internal()`, because anything below that value will be
obsolete by the time `ZSTD_updateTree_internal()` completes.

Nick Terrell c2555f8c6f [lib] Fix fuzzer timeouts by backing off overflow correction
Linearly back off the frequency of overflow correction based on the
number of times the `ZSTD_window_t` has been overflow corrected. This
will still allow the fuzzer to quickly find overflow correction bugs,
while also keeping good speed for larger inputs.

Additionally, the `nbOverflowCorrections` variable can be useful for
debugging coredumps, since we can inspect the `ZSTD_CCtx` to see if
overflow correction has happened yet.

I've verified this fixes the timeouts in OSS-Fuzz (176 seconds -> 6
seconds). I've also verified that fuzzers and `fuzzer` and `zstreamtest`
still catch the row-hash overflow correction bug.
